Job Summary

The Scientist will provide scientific and technical leadership for the AIR and Routine IHC team with responsibility for leading (but not limited to) complex high-priority projects and expanding the scope and capabilities of AIR and IHC services.

The Scientist will independently design and execute experiments develop and optimize assays and protocols troubleshoot complex technical challenges interpret scientific data and provide expert guidance on immunohistochemistry (IHC) immunofluorescence (IF) multiplex immunofluorescence (mIF) RNA in-situ hybridization and related biomarker applications.

The role will also contribute to the development of new services products and scientific capabilities while mentoring junior scientists and supporting the continued growth and efficiency of the AIR and IHC team.

Qualifications

  • Ph.D. in Biology Molecular Biology Neuroscience Immunology Pathology Biomedical Sciences or a related life sciences field; M.S. with substantial relevant industry experience may also be considered.
  • Strong hands-on experience with immunohistochemistry (IHC) immunofluorescence (IF) and/or in situ hybridization (ISH) techniques.
  • Experience with antibody optimization assay development troubleshooting and validation including evaluation of staining specificity sensitivity background and appropriate controls.
  • Strong understanding of tissue biology histology biomarkers and experimental design.
  • Experience working with FFPE and/or frozen tissue samples from human or preclinical species.
  • Ability to independently analyze experimental results identify potential sources of assay failure and develop appropriate troubleshooting strategies.
  • Experience with automated staining platforms such as the Leica BOND RX is preferred.
  • Strong organizational and documentation skills including accurate maintenance of experimental records protocols reagent information and project documentation.
  • Comfortable working in a fast-paced CRO environment where project priorities and experimental requirements may vary across clients.
  • Ability to train and mentor junior laboratory staff and provide technical guidance on assay execution and troubleshooting.
  • Familiarity with GLP GCLP CLIA/CAP or other regulated laboratory environments is beneficial but not required.
